> Besides the discussion about `subfiles' package, I think `amsthm.el'
> could do a better job reg. new environments defined and optional
> headings. Further it has a bug in the way it uses `TeX-arg-length':
> '("newtheoremstyle" "Style name" (TeX-arg-length nil "Space above")
> (TeX-arg-length nil "Space below") "Body font" "Indent amount"
> "Theorem head font" "Punctuation after head"
> (TeX-arg-length nil "Space after head") "Theorem head spec"))
> The string "Space above" for example becomes `Initial-Input' and not
> `Prompt'. I'm attaching an improved version of `amsthm.el'. Could you
> give it a try? I have never used the package so I would be grateful if
> you could test it and give some feedback here.
